Terence began his career in the seafood industry in 1995 when he was hired by David Marabella as a fish wrapper/local delivery driver. He became the warehouse manager a few years later after working in other departments and learning how each department functioned. After a short hiatus away from the industry, he returned to GVIS and was groomed to be the fresh fish buyer at the Honolulu Fish Auction. After several years of buying at the auction, he left again for a short time and worked for several other companies and did some commercial fishing as well.
He finally returned “home” in 2005 when he was offered a spot in the department he always thought was the missing piece to his seafood journey, Sales. On occasion, he’ll give the current fish buyer a well deserved break by buying at the auction, but more so to “keep his knife sharp”. He feels the knowledge he gained working for Bob and Dave as well as others in the industry, has helped him to better service customers of Garden & Valley Isle Seafood.
